Near Pair of Angel-Molded Lead Planters
third quarter 18th century, English, the angels standing contrapposto on domed bases, supporting oval reeded planters on the tops of their heads.
h. 25-1/2" to 27-1/2", w. 14", d. 11-1/4"
Provenance: Estate of Edward "Ted" L'Engle Baker and Ann McDonald Baker, Jacksonville, Florida.
